What Makes an ATV Compact?

The engine power in compact ATVs balances performance with efficiency. While they typically feature smaller engines, these models are engineered to provide adequate torque and horsepower for recreational riding, ensuring they remain fun to drive without sacrificing reliability.

A small turning radius is another important aspect of compact ATVs, allowing them to navigate through tight trails and obstacles efficiently. This feature enhances the rider’s confidence, especially in challenging terrains where precision is essential.

The suspension system on compact ATVs is designed to be effective yet unobtrusive. A good suspension absorbs bumps and provides a smooth ride without adding unnecessary height or weight to the vehicle, ensuring that riders enjoy comfort without compromising on agility.

Lastly, storage capacity in compact ATVs is often creatively maximized. Many models come with built-in compartments or racks that allow users to carry essential gear without increasing the vehicle’s size, making them practical for day trips or work-related tasks.

Why Choose a Compact ATV Over Standard Models?

Choosing a compact ATV over standard models primarily occurs due to the versatility, maneuverability, and ease of storage that compact ATVs offer, making them ideal for a variety of terrains and users.

According to a study by the Specialty Vehicle Institute of America (SVIA), compact ATVs are increasingly favored for recreational and utility purposes because they combine the functionality of larger models with a size that allows for easier handling and transport. This trend is supported by consumer preferences for vehicles that can navigate tighter spaces without sacrificing performance.

The underlying mechanism for this preference stems from the design features of compact ATVs, which typically include lighter weights and shorter wheelbases. These attributes contribute to enhanced agility and responsiveness in off-road conditions. As compact ATVs are easier to control, they reduce the risk of accidents, particularly for novice riders and those using them in confined areas, such as wooded trails or agricultural settings.

Moreover, compact ATVs often come with better fuel efficiency due to their smaller engines and lighter frames, making them more economical for users who need to operate the vehicle for extended periods. This efficiency also aligns with the growing consumer awareness regarding environmental impact and fuel costs, thus increasing the appeal of compact models further.

What Key Features Should You Prioritize When Selecting a Compact ATV?

When selecting the best compact ATV, consider the following key features:

  • Size and Weight: The compact size and lightweight design are crucial for maneuverability and transportability, allowing for easier navigation in tight trails and easier loading onto vehicles.
  • Engine Performance: Look for a balance of power and efficiency; an engine that offers sufficient horsepower for various terrains while maintaining good fuel economy can enhance your riding experience.
  • Suspension System: A well-designed suspension system is essential for providing comfort and stability on rough terrain, helping to absorb shocks and improve handling during rides.
  • Storage Capacity: Adequate storage options, such as racks and compartments, are important for carrying gear and supplies, enhancing the utility of the ATV for outdoor adventures.
  • Durability and Build Quality: A robust frame and quality materials are vital for withstanding harsh conditions and extended use, ensuring that the ATV can endure tough environments without frequent repairs.
  • Safety Features: Prioritize ATVs equipped with features like automatic braking systems, lights, and protective gear to enhance rider safety, especially for beginners or those riding in challenging conditions.
  • Ease of Maintenance: Choose models that offer easy access to components for maintenance, as this can save time and effort in keeping your ATV in optimal condition over the years.

What Are the Common Uses and Benefits of Owning a Compact ATV?

Compact ATVs are popular for various practical uses and benefits that cater to a wide range of activities.

  • Recreational Use: Compact ATVs are ideal for recreational activities such as trail riding and off-road adventures. Their smaller size makes them easier to maneuver through tight spaces and challenging terrains, providing an exciting experience for riders.
  • Utility Work: Many owners use compact ATVs for utility purposes, such as farm work or landscaping. Their ability to carry loads and navigate rough terrain makes them valuable tools for transporting equipment or materials in areas where larger vehicles cannot access.
  • Hunting and Fishing: Compact ATVs are excellent for outdoor enthusiasts who engage in hunting or fishing. They can transport gear and supplies to remote locations, allowing users to reach secluded spots without disturbing the environment, making them an essential asset for outdoor activities.
  • Land Management: Compact ATVs are often used for land management tasks, including trail maintenance and wildlife monitoring. Their versatility enables users to effectively manage properties, clear trails, and monitor wildlife without causing significant disruption to the landscape.
  • Family-Friendly Recreation: Many compact ATVs are designed with safety features and can accommodate younger or less experienced riders, making them family-friendly options. This promotes family bonding through shared outdoor experiences while ensuring that safety remains a priority.
